Dwarf Fortress is a single-player, high fantasy simulation game in the style of old ASCII Roguelikes. You can control either a Dwarven clan attempting to build a settlement or a single adventurer in a randomly generated and persistent world complete with its own unique history.

Also, Anybody who buys this book. There is ONE big problem with it so far early on. DON'T set your worlds to generate minerals "Everywhere". Thanks to a current bug it will crowd out "Flux Metals" in the finder screen and you will not be able to find a suitable site based on his site finder setting recommendations.
